『壹』 android的九宮格圖片怎麼實現跳轉另一個Activity,本人初學者,九宮圖代碼是拷別人的,復雜,求大神
先獲取九宮格的監聽事件,在監聽事件里添加跳轉方法:
Intent intent=new Intent(A_Activity.this, B_Activity.class);
startActivity(intent);
A_Activity——>當前的Activity名
B_Activity——>你所要跳轉的另一全Activity名
『貳』 android GridView ImageView 想實現點擊圖片 跳轉後顯示相應圖片
mBigImageView.setImageResource(mId[mItemId]);這行錯了!你傳過來的是圖片資源的id,怎麼當成數組下標了!?
mBigImageView.setImageResource(mItemId);按道理應該這么寫,但是你在兩個activity里都存取了圖片數組,就會生成不同的圖片資源id,所以第一個activity里傳過去的id有可能永遠都沒法在第二個activity里找到需要的圖片
正確做法是:
用一個公共資源類存儲這個圖片數組,在這兩個activity里直接引用就行,如:
public
class
Picture{
public
static
final
int
pic[]
=
{
R.drawable.v1,
R.drawable.v2,
R.drawable.v3,
R.drawable.v4,
R.drawable.v5
......
};
}
而且通常正確的做法時,點擊gridview某一item時,直接把這個item的position傳遞過去就行,根據position在數組里找到圖片,很省事
『叄』 android開發,如何實現將一個按鈕拖動到某個固定圖片的位置後,跳轉到另一個界面
按鈕其實用imageview也能用的吧?,給imageview做一個touch點擊事件之後,你手指拖動,坐標就會改變,拖動到你固定的坐標區域時,用intent來跳轉頁面
『肆』 安卓點擊imageview跳轉到另外一個頁面
安卓編程事先等待幾秒可以使用Handler類,該類有延時的方法,示例如下:
Runnable runnable=new Runnable(){//新建一個線程
@Override
public void run() {
Intent intent = new Intent();//新建一個意圖,也就是跳轉的界面
intent.setAction("com.iStudy.Study.Main");
startActivity(intent);//開始跳轉
finish();
}
};
Handler handler = new Handler();
handler.postDelayed(runnable, 1500);//等待1.5秒之後執行跳轉,這個數值可以自己修改。
『伍』 Android應用開發--如何點擊圖片跳轉activity
圖片可能默認是不能被點擊的
要在XML中設置一下,clickable
然後在試試
『陸』 android 點擊圖片跳轉到第二個activity
@Override
protected void onActivityResult(int requestCode, int resultCode, Intent data) {
// TODO Auto-generated method stub
super.onActivityResult(requestCode, resultCode, data);
}
這是activity中的方法,用startActivityForResult方法啟動第二個activity,第二個activity返回的時候就會調用這個方法。詳細用法自己網上找一下,主要是onActivityResult
『柒』 Android Studio中如何實現圖片點擊跳轉有幫助必定採納!
給ImageView 綁定clicklistener
『捌』 android canvas畫的圖怎麼實現點擊跳轉
重寫onTuchEvent,在case down 中判斷點擊的坐標是否在 你畫的圖上面
如果圖片是矩形,可以把矩形new 出來,然後判斷這個矩形是否包含這個點
如果輸不規則圖形,可以用path來構建
Rect rect = new Rect();
if (rect.contains((int) event_x, (int) event_y)) {
//點擊了
}